## Deployment

Before deploying Lanternmoth, be aware of a known memory leak in its image cache: the eviction thread stalls under sustained load, so resident memory grows until restart. We mitigate this with a hard cap and a scheduled nightly recycle. Both safeguards must stay enabled in every environment. The relevant settings are as follows:

deployment values, yafop-tahof:
HOLIX_HOST=holix.zemvarsys.internal
HOLIX_PORT=3306

Deploy step 4 — Routevane driver-assignment heuristic. Before rolling the new scorer to the Calderport fleet, confirm the shadow-mode comparison ran for at least 48 hours and the assignment-delta dashboard shows under 3% divergence. Then bump HEURISTIC_VERSION in the deploy manifest and restart the matcher pods in order. The scorer calls the fleet telemetry API on boot, which requires a service credential in the environment. Add that credential to .env on the following line.

sealed setting: ARCHIVE_KEY3=8d0

## Local setup — Graphlet

Graphlet renders dependency graphs from the Marrow build index. Clone the repo, install deps with the bundled script, and start the renderer on port 4000. It needs read access to the index tables to resolve edges. For local development, point Graphlet at the shared staging database using the connection string below.

primary connection of yagep-kahip = redis://giliel_svc:zYiKsLL2PLpfPL@db-348f.xolmarsys.corp:5432/fenwyn

Action item: map-tile prefetcher cache bound (Wayfern incident)

Owner: platform team. The Wayfern prefetcher filled disk on three edge nodes, degrading map loads for two hours. Fix: enforce a hard cache ceiling and evict by region age. Support should flag any repeat reports of blank tiles as possible recurrence. Status updates and the rollout schedule are tracked on the page below.

wiki page, bageg-kahif: https://gitlab.qorvellabs.internal/view/spaces/job/2a5e7e5f1a93